#b3cc8d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3cc8d is composed of 70.2% red, 80%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.9%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 83.8 degrees, a saturation of 38.2% and a lightness of 67.6%. #b3cc8d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#67991b.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#b3cc8d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b3cc8d has RGB values of R:179, G:204,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 11783309.
